首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>反应式表单验证器在后退按钮(浏览器)上不起作用-角度

反应式表单验证器在后退按钮(浏览器)上不起作用-角度
EN

Stack Overflow用户
提问于 2020-09-05 18:51:51
回答 1查看 148关注 0票数 0

在我的开发过程中,我面临着一个问题,我已经创建了带有响应式验证的登录表单。它工作正常,但当我移动到不同的组件(如创建帐户),然后单击后退按钮/图像进入主页,然后验证消息()停止显示错误,但当我单击提交按钮时,它显示无效状态,但没有消息。总有一天能告诉我为什么会这样。示例如下:

代码语言:javascript
运行
复制
<Form class="" [formGroup]="loginForm" novalidate>           
<input matInput formControlName="email" placeholder="Email" type="email" #email> 
 <mat-error>
required
 </mat-error>
</Form>

第一次它是显示,但在后退按钮单击后,它不工作,我需要刷新页面,然后它开始工作。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2020-09-07 20:21:48

我找到解决方案了。这是由于css造成的。实际上textbox & Button隐藏了屏幕中的错误。当我给出更多的文本框和按钮之间的间距时,错误就会显示出来。因此,文本框/按钮高度覆盖了错误,因此我们无法看到。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/63753090

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档